摘要
We present a simulation algorithm for a diffusion on a curved surface given by the equation phi(r) = 0. The algorithm is tested against analytical results known for diffusion on a cylinder and a sphere, and applied to the diffusion on the P, DI and G periodic nodal surfaces. It should find application in: an interpretation of two-dimensional exchange NMR spectroscopy data of, diffusion on biological membranes. [S1063-651X(99)12107-X].
